17 #ifndef TEAMCENTER__REVISIONNAMERULE__HXX
18 #define TEAMCENTER__REVISIONNAMERULE__HXX
21 #include <common/tc_deprecation_macros.h>
24 #include <property/libproperty_exports.h>
28 class RevisionNameRule;
32 class RevisionNameRuleImpl;
36 class RevisionNameRuleDelegate;
40 class RevisionNameRuleDispatch;
44 class RevisionNameRuleGenImpl;
106 int getRule_name( std::string &value,
bool &isNull )
const;
196 int setRule_name(
const std::string &value,
bool isNull=
false );
244 virtual void initialize( ::Teamcenter::RootObjectImpl* impl );
283 friend class RevisionNameRuleDelegate;
284 friend class RevisionNameRuleGenImpl;
287 #include <property/libproperty_undef.h>
288 #endif // TEAMCENTER__REVISIONNAMERULE__HXX